The Old English sheepdog has been known as the “Dulux dog” since the breed started appearing in advertisements for the paint in the 1960s.
Why did Dulux use a dog? Dulux was the first paint brand to advertise on TV! … It is rumoured that ‘Dash’ the dog belonged to the advert’s director and kept on running onto the set to play with the child actors. When editing the footage, the scenes he was in looked so good they didn’t get cut and the rest as they say is history.
Who was the original Dulux dog? The first Dulux dog was Shepton Daphnis Horsa, pet name Dash, who held the role for eight years, owned by Eva Sharp in Tottenham.

Is the Dulux dog real in the adverts?
The dog of the original advert was called Shepton Daphnis Horsa, affectionately known as Dash. When Dash retired, a competition to find his replacement saw 450 Old English Sheepdog owners enter their dogs. The winner of the competition, at London’s Café Royal, was Digby.
Is the Dulux dog real?
All of the Dulux dogs (apart from Dash) have been breed champions, with five of them winning ‘Best in Show’ prizes. In fact, Old English Sheepdogs have become synonymous with Dulux, the term ‘Dulux Dog’ being a common nickname for the breed.

How many Old English Sheepdogs are there?
Today there are less than 1,000. In both the U.S. and England, the OES is now an endangered breed that faces extinction and breed advocates are working to rekindle the love affair for the amiable, kind and intelligent puff of a dog.

Is sheepdog a breed? The Pastoral breed group
Usually this type of dog has a weatherproof double coat to protect it from the elements when working in severe conditions. Breeds such as the Collie family, Old English Sheepdogs and Samoyeds who have been herding reindeer for centuries are but a few included in this group.

Do all Old English Sheepdogs turn grey?
They are also always gray with white trim as adults. Puppies are born with dark patches that are almost black. The black gradually fades and turns a shade of gray or blue with maturity. The first Old English Sheepdogs came to America in the 1880s and were a hit among the upper class.
